X-Git-Url: https://mattmccutchen.net/rsync/rsync.git/blobdiff_plain/36e2ea60688439bc4a217e2b715dae5543276d2d..88897638a98d39721a059e44ebcbcdcdcaf80df1:/hlink.c diff --git a/hlink.c b/hlink.c index 77d0dc03..2ef998c6 100644 --- a/hlink.c +++ b/hlink.c @@ -83,6 +83,7 @@ static void link_idev_data(void) FPTR(cur)->F_HLINDEX = to; FPTR(cur)->F_NEXT = hlink_list[++from]; + FPTR(cur)->link_u.links->link_dest_used = 0; } pool_free(idev_pool, 0, FPTR(cur)->link_u.idev); if (from > start) { @@ -94,6 +95,7 @@ static void link_idev_data(void) FPTR(cur)->F_HLINDEX = to; FPTR(cur)->F_NEXT = head; FPTR(cur)->flags |= FLAG_HLINK_EOL; + FPTR(cur)->link_u.links->link_dest_used = 0; hlink_list[to++] = head; } else FPTR(cur)->link_u.links = NULL;